Jacques Coetzee

Scrumhalf Jacques Coetzee is, despite still being just 26 years old, a very experienced South African No.9.
A junior star with the Golden Lions, Coetzee made his senior professional debut with the Pumas in 2007. In three years with the Currie Cup side he has established himself as a top quality scrumhalf and highly regarded professional.
Coetzee was a member of the impressive Royal XV side which pushed the 2009 touring British and Irish Lions all the way. In 2010 Coetzee made his Super rugby debut, with the Lions, and gained a number of good reviews for his performances in the Currie Cup competition.
Following the 2010 Currie Cup, Coetzee joined the ambitious Eastern Province Kings for the new season - featuring for them in a number of the Super Rugby pre- season fixtures in early 2011.
Date of Birth: 22/10/84
Position: Scrumhalf
Height: 1.75m
Weight: 81kg
Currently contracted to: Griquas
Rugby Career:
2011: Eastern Province Kings (Vodacom Cup)2010: Pumas (Currie Cup Premier Division), Pumas (Vodacom Cup), Lions (Super 14)
2009: Pumas (Currie Cup First Division), Royal XV (British & Irish Lions Tour), Pumas (Vodacom Cup)
2008: Pumas (Currie Cup First Division), Pumas (Vodacom Cup)
2007: Pumas (Currie Cup First Division), Pumas (ABSA Currie Cup Qualifiers), Pumas (Vodacom Cup)
2006: University of Johannesburg (National Club Championships)
2005: Golden Lions (Under-21 Competition)
